JOB QUALIFICATIONS / REQUIREMENTS / D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Applicants must hold or be eligible to hold a North Carolina teaching license in appropriate licensure area. Applicants must hold or be eligible to obtain a school bus license for North Carolina Experience in organizing and operating all aspects of an athletic program preferred. Previous coaching experience as Head Varsity Coach. Experience leading others, including supervising and collaborating with adults. Experience managing or working with an (athletic program) budget.
Goal:
Provide opportunities for all enrolled students to participate in an extracurricular athletics that will develop physical skills, build a sense of worth and competence, and foster an appreciation for the enjoyment and lifelong value of sports. Build strong relationships with community stakeholders, including families, local organizations, and supporters of the athletic program. Model and promote calm, professional behavior in all situations, while teaching and practicing effective conflict resolution skills within athletic programs. Integrate, model and measure leadership development as directed by the Leader in Me framework into each sport and the overall athletic program by promoting the principles of fair play and good sportsmanship while developing student leaders through teamwork, accountability and character.
Duties:
The athletic director will provide a list of all equipment to the principal on a yearly basis. The athletic director shall oversee and implement all coach evaluations. The athletic director shall meet with parents as requested. The athletic director shall ensure all sports are treated equitably and will advocate for all sports. The athletic director shall provide a means for all coaches to have input in the needs assessment for each sport. (A needs assessment form will be provided to each coach at the beginning of the school year. The form must be returned to the athletic director and reviewed by the principal.) The athletic director will create an athletic budget and will meet as needed with the principal to review all athletic accounts including athletics, individual sports accounts, and booster accounts. The athletic director will develop a budget based on the average of the past 3
  • 5 years of gate receipts.
The budget will be presented to the administration for approval and submitted to the county athletic director. The operational budget and financial procedures are to include: Preparation and supervision of the athletic budget. Direct sale of tickets for all contests. Follow proper financial procedures for cash handling and gate/ticket receipts. Collect all monies from the athletic contests and deposit in the appropriate accounts. Ensure that all money raised or collected by the school will be deposited in appropriate school athletic account. Ensure that the donations from the booster organizations are equitable dispersed among all sports and used for those intended fundraising activities by the boosters. The athletic director will develop a master schedule for all competitions to include all athletic events for the school year. The schedule will be submitted to the principal for approval. The principal will submit the master schedule to the office of the Lincoln County Schools Athletic Director. The schedule will provide equity for all sports in the use of facilities for competitions. The athletic director will develop a schedule to ensure equal access to all weight rooms for male and female athletes. The athletic director will work with the Lincoln County Schools Department of Transportation to schedule activity buses. The athletic director will ensure that all activity buses are returned clean and on time to the appropriate site. The athletic director will coordinate with the maintenance department, the repair and maintenance of all facility needs which are utilized by the athletic department. The athletic director will provide the principal with the eligibility lists for all sports for their approval. The AD will ensure the below requirements are met for each athlete of each sport. Domicile or Residency Requirements, LCS Policy 4120 Attendance, LCS Policy 4400 Athletic Transfer Guidelines LCS Policy 4151 Promotion Guidelines Concussion Paperwork Physical Dates The athletic director will ensure all rules and regulations as mandated by the NCHSAA are enforced with all sports at each sporting event. The athletic director will ensure that coaches have the information on all pre-season paperwork turned in before participating in any school sponsored athletic activities including but not limited to try-outs and practice. The athletic director will work with coaches to ensure try-outs for sports are held appropriately which is defined as announcing dated and times of tryouts in a timely manner, equal access to tryouts, and a measurable rubric to measure the athlete's performance during tryouts. The athletic director will work with each coach to address facility needs and maintenance of all athletic facilities including locker rooms, competition fields practice fields, and weight rooms. The athletic director will provide documentation to the principal that all head coaches and assistant coaches have attended the required rules session and taken the appropriate course work issued by the NCHSAA. The athletic director shall provide security at all events held on site or off-site as needed to maintain the safety and integrity of the scheduled event. The AD will also ensure that the appropriate staff is in place for crowd control based on our Fire Marshall's recommendations. The athletic director will work to resolve any conflicts within the coaching staffs. The athletic director will act as a tournament manager for all league and tournament playoff activities that are assigned to the school. The athletic director will plan and supervise the athletic awards programs with the cooperation of the administrators and coaches. The athletic director will attend and serve as the school liaison at athletic booster organizations meetings. The athletic director will assist the administration in the preparation and distribution of complimentary passes for the school. The athletic director will prepare and obtain signed game contracts when appropriate. The athletic director will ensure that all coaches carry out the pre-season meetings with parents and athletes and ensure all pre-season paperwork is signed and returned. The athletic director will ensure that all athletic facilities are prepared for practice and/or competition. The athletic director will develop a preventative maintenance schedule for all facilities and equipment. The athletic director will report all coaches who are ejected or disqualified from an event to the principal and the Lincoln County Athletic Director. Must be eligible and willing to obtain CDL bus driver's license for driving the Activity bus. Other duties as assigned.
